Output fdfce2cfbe8236ad6fd8a89b374d5df86df67f9aa35d954aaad3aa70904cdb76:15

value
132264
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f90f68d8fb02d6d0f9c7f3f9f9f6bdd6079c4598 OP_EQUAL
address
3QPvdz4QQMdHexJxs6bMykaDob89CMQKG3
transaction
fdfce2cfbe8236ad6fd8a89b374d5df86df67f9aa35d954aaad3aa70904cdb76
confirmations
2050
spent
true